    trane RTAC Chiller



    Hi,

    anybody can please explain me about rtac screw chiller minimum and maximum limit of below


    OIL TEMP MAX AND MIN

    INTERMEDIAE OIL PRESSURE MIN AND MAX

    REFRIGERANT LEVEL MIN AND MAX

    APPROCH TEMP MIN AND MAX

    Hi, Max oil temp is 93°C. If the female is not loaded and the oil temperature is near cut out then CH530 energize female in order to decrease oil temp till 77°C. As a rule of thumb normal oil pressure, when female is loaded, should be approximately 1Bar below high pressure. Specifically the oil pressure is controlled by the following formula: {(High Pressure – Oil Pressure) / (High Pressure – Low Pressure)}. When the female is energized the result which generates a low oil flow alarm is 0,25. When the female is not energized the limit is 0,5. The refrigerant level can vary from -1” to +1” (-25,4mm to +25,4mm). Normal operation is at 0mm. The normal approach for this kind of evaporator (Falling Film) is about 1,5°C.
